Ness Running Club has been awarded £1,200 towards its 2025 North Lewis 5/10k and fun run, which will be held on Saturday 6th December. Our Community Investment Fund (CIF) has contributed towards the funding of the run for the last couple of years, valuing the importance of the event and the training leading up to it. This year, due to the success and longevity of the run, we have awarded Ness Running Club a three-year sponsorship CIF award in support of the event.
This community event, which celebrates its 16th event this year, is now firmly established on the island’s running calendar and continues to be well supported by both the runners and volunteers who turn out each year.
This event contributes towards our Care and Wellbeing and Exceptional Place strategic priorities, helping to improve health and wellbeing, provide volunteer opportunities, improve social inclusion and help relieve poverty. The run, which takes place in Ness every December, is all about people working together; running or volunteering, from the youngest to the oldest, the community comes together to make the event the success that it is.
